  • Obituary
    O'Brien, William Anthony (late of Timaru and 43 Mathesons Road, Christchurch): On December 20, 1973 at Christchurch, dearly loved father of Dennis, Daryl, Adrian, Nigel, Sharyn and Janis, dearly loved father-in-law of Marylyn and Margaret and dealy loved granddad of Carl and Micheal, aged 53 years.

    His wife Nancy Isabelle O'Brien (nee Stratford) died 10 September 2014 (Timaru Herald 13 September 2014). AWMM
